The Automatic Answer with Delay Message feature answers incoming CO/
PBX calls and plays a specified message to the outside caller while still
ringing designated stations. Up to two messages can be played to the
outside caller. The message(s) played are the same as the Automated
Attendant message(s).
Terminal Type
Not applicable.
Required Components
VRS(4)-U( ) ETU
